Output 08dc51f72555f220a92b493e5278cc7e9bb446203e4b85d97ae9a20b7e66bf92:0

value
3061268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df77b4c385735ea8cbd30f57ebc670366faf88ba OP_EQUAL
address
3N4c1eYfzstyc1zg7QVxbs3MJeHw5jEGsk
transaction
08dc51f72555f220a92b493e5278cc7e9bb446203e4b85d97ae9a20b7e66bf92
confirmations
142767
spent
true